Payne County County can be found in the Oklahoma area. Stillwater – is the county seat. Payne County has a total population of 81575 and was formed in 1890.

Payne County County has a total area of 684 square miles. The zip codes in Payne County County are 74023, 74032, 74059, 74062, 74074, 74075, 74076, 74077, 74078, 74085.

Payne County Jail, OK is run and operated by the Payne County County Sherriff Office. The specific address of the Payne County Jail is 606 South Husband Street, Stillwater, OK, 74074.

Payne County Jail mostly serves inmates awaiting sentencing or trial. Most inmates who pass through this Payne County Jail are there for a period of 3 years or less.

The Payne County Jail is classified as a medium-security center located in Stillwater, Payne County. Payne County Jail houses adult inmates who with good behavior, can acquire a trustee status and work at the Payne County Jail for a fee or reduce their sentences.

Sending a Mail/Care Package

Payne County Jail, OK has a smart communication system that scans all mails that come into the Payne County Jail before availing it to the inmate through the Payne County Jail facility's kiosk. This is done to ensure a Payne County Jail secure system that prevents the sneaking of contraband through the mail.

The Payne County Jail also affords inmates the option of sending mail through the normal snail mail and adding a photograph for an extra $4.

If you want to send a package to the Payne County Jail, you have to contact the Payne County Jail and get permission.

Sending Money

There are a couple of options at Payne County Jail for friends and family to send money to the Payne County Jail inmate commissary, including check, money order, or cashier. You also have the option of depositing money directly at the Payne County Jail if you happen to go.

Phone calls

Inmates at the Payne County Jail have phone call privileges between 8AM and 7PM daily. There is a time restriction per inmate per phone call, 41 minutes during normal hours, and 15 minutes during rush hours. Phone calls will be monitored by Payne County Jail’s staff for security reasons.

Visitation

Before visiting the Payne County Jail, ensure that you first get on their approved list of visitors. The best option will be first calling the Payne County Jail and confirming with Payne County Jail authorities.

Some rules need to be followed to get admission into the Payne County Jail. Some of Payne County Jail’s rules include the visitor not being a former felon; have a valid Oklahoma ID, and guardians for the underage. For further clarity of these information, therefore, visit the website .
